Can You Take Escitalopram and Losartan Together?
No documented interaction was identified between losartan and escitalopram in the sources reviewed.

What the interaction means
Losartan's FDA prescribing information and MedlinePlus page do not mention escitalopram, SSRIs, or serotonin reuptake inhibitors anywhere. Escitalopram's FDA prescribing information -- including its Section 5.7 bleeding-risk subsection and a full-text search of the entire document -- and its MedlinePlus page do not mention losartan, ARBs, or angiotensin receptor blockers anywhere.
No documented interaction was identified in the authoritative sources reviewed. This is not a guarantee that no interaction exists for every dose, formulation, or individual -- it means the sources checked did not document one.
